Le Casematte Nero d’Avola IGP
100% Nero d’Avola. Intense ruby red tending towards garnet, this Nero d’Avola has a vast array of fruity aromas with notes of ripe plum. The flavor is mouth-filling and warm with fragrant grapey notes and good acidity.

Vineyard Information
Grapes: 100% Nero d’Avola
Region: Sicily
Vineyards: From a vineyard located in Butera
Exposure: South
Altitude: 984 feet above sea level
Soil: Calcareous terrain
Vine Training: Guyot
Vine Age: 15-20 years
Time of Harvest: Mid-September
Vine Density: 2,024-2,430 vines per acre
Winemaking Information
Total Production: 25,000 bottles
Vinification Process: The grapes are hand-harvested in mid-September and undergo Vinification in stainless-steel.
Aging Process: The wine ages in stainless steel for six months and three to four months in bottle.
Alcohol Content: 13.00%
Winemaker: Carlo Ferrini
Cellaring: Up to 5 years
Closure: Cork
